Bramshott Camp

28-7-18

Dear Addie:-

Just a few lines to let you know I received your letter today dated July 8th and was very glad to hear from you as there is always lots of news in your letters that the rest wouldn't be bothered telling me. I guess its something awful all the new things they are getting preparing for that great event that will be over long before you get his letter.

Tell Laura she out to start and get with Angus Newberry he is only about 85. I hope Perces ankle is better by this time but I would have liked to have seen him after he came from under the tar bucket.

I got the parcel that you and Bertha sent me and it was certainly good too. Tell Perce if he isn't too busy she might drop me a line some time and let me know how everything is going.

Well as this is about all I can think of I will have to close so.

Write Soon

Good Bye

Allan
